Today is the birthday of Carlo, one of my very good friends back in Manila.

To many, he is known as the graphic artist/creator of the superhero ZsaZsa Zaturnnah. The graphic novel has gone a long way since it was published several years ago. It's been made into a movie. It's been made into a musical. It has been cited in studies.
